World War One presented in an easy way for your students to understand.

How did one seemingly small incident start a chain of events that lead to one of the largest conflicts in world history?

Why was this event called the Great War? How did it bring about national pride and independence in New Zealand?

In this programme students will explore the stories of soldiers and objects from the museum collection. They will gain an understanding of what was going on in the world at that time and how NZ became involved in this global event
